    In his Meeting with Sayyid Ammar al-Hakim, the Sudanese Ambassador Praises the Democratic Experience in Iraq, Expressing his Country’s Will to Develop the Relations between both Countries

     
    The Sudanese ambassador to Iraq extended his congratulations for the success of the Iraqi experience in holding the parliamentary elections, expressing his country’s will to develop its relations with Iraq in the best interest of both sister countries and peoples.
    This came during a meeting between Sayyid Ammar al-Hakim, head of the Islamic Supreme Council of Iraq, held in his office in Baghdad on Thursday, May 15, 2014, and the Sudanese ambassador to Iraq, Mr. Muhammed Amr Moussa. His Eminence confirmed the strong relations between Iraq and Sudan, hoping for more cooperation between both countries in different areas.
